Greenwood Native Appointed CEO of a Memphis Credit Union

In a significant development, a Greenwood native, Raffael “Ralph” Crockett, has been officially selected to serve as the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of the Shelby County Federal Credit Union, headquartered in Memphis.

Shelby County Federal Credit Union Expresses Confidence In Crockett

Shelby County Federal Credit Union, a reputable institution established with the mission of providing low-cost financial services to its members, declared this news earlier last week. The change in leadership comes with an optimistic note from the Board of Directors of the Credit Union.

Expressing their trust in Ralph’s expertise, the Board strongly believes in his capabilities to direct the establishment into a new phase of development and sustained prosperity, translating the original vision of the credit union into reality.
